Gardaí are investigating two criminal incidents at Mountain Top Letterkenny last Saturday morning.
The first incident occurred at a car dealership, where vehicles were deliberately damaged, before a nearby shop was robbed a short time later.
One line of inquiry taken by gardaí is that the two crimes may be linked.
Entry was gained to a car dealership between 3am-4am in the early hours of Saturday morning. Damage was caused to a number of vehicles.
Later, a group of youths stole from a local shop. The alarm of the premises was activated at 5.35 am and gardaí discovered that a small window was opened at the front of the premises. CCTV footage showed three males on the premises, and one reached into the window and lifted a packet of batteries. They fled the scene.
Gardaí say two of the males were wearing dark clothing and the third was wearing a grey tracksuit and a white
baseball cap.
Entry was not gained to the shop, but gardaí are keen to speak with anybody who may have been travelling through Mountain Top on the night of the incidents. Anyone with dashcam footage is asked to make it available to gardaí.
